Zamoyski-Palace in Warsaw - Entrance gate

Ulica Foksal 1, Warszawa

Neo-Renaissance palace of the landowner Konstanty Zamoyski in downtown Warsaw. The building was erected in 1875 by Polish architect Leandro Marconi. It has 11 axes, two short side wings and two outbuildings. A decorative entrance portal separates the symmetrical complex from the street. Since 1949, the palace has been the headquarters of the Polish Association of Architects SARP. These initials can be seen on the portal as well as above the entrance to the palace.

The property directly borders the Przeździecki Palace to the west.
